BB: Lasell drops one-run game to Emerson; late rally lifts Lions

DANVERS, Mass. – Emerson College scored five runs in the bottom of the ninth inning Wednesday afternoon to pull out a 9-8 victory over Lasell University in a non-conference baseball game at St. John's Prep.

Emerson improves to 3-8 overall, while Lasell drops to 2-3.

The Lions took a 3-0 lead in the bottom of the first inning on a three-run home run by sophomore Quinton Copeland (Houston, Texas). The Lasers battled back to tie the score with two runs in the fourth inning and one more in the fifth. Junior Charlie Danaher (Guilford, Conn.) drew a bases-loaded walk to put the Lasers on the board in the fourth, and sophomore Matt Motyka (Vernon, Conn.) accounted for the next two runs, stealing home in the fourth and delivering an RBI single in the fifth.

After Emerson regained the lead in the last of the fifth on a solo home run by senior Cam Beattie (Gilbert, Ariz.), the Lasers roared into the lead with three runs in the seventh inning and two more in the eighth. Junior Harrison Silva (Lowell, Mass.) hit an RBI single to right to tie the score at 4-4, and classmate Brian Cipolla (Cranston, R.I.) followed with a two-run double to left. Junior Wyatt Sihvonen (Lebanon, Conn.) tripled home a run in the eighth, and came home on a sacrifice fly by junior Joe Sullivan (Sandwich, Mass.).

Emerson rallied with five runs on four hits and an error in the ninth inning. Freshman Thai Morgan (Waldwick, N.J.) brought home a run with an infield RBI single; Copeland drove in two with a single up the middle; Morgan scored on an infield ground out; and freshman Matt Nachamie (Merrick, N.Y.) knocked in the winning run with a single to left.

Sihvonen finished with three hits for Lasell, and Cipolla drove in three. Motyka and Silva also collected two hits apiece. Copeland finished 2-for-4 with five RBI for Emerson, and Morgan had four hits on five trips to the plate.

Sophomore Bryan Simmons-Hayes (Natick, Mass.) earned the win (2-0) in relief for the Lions, while senior Zach Handzel (Palmer, Mass.) was saddled with the loss (1-2) for Lasell. Senior Patrick Colvin (Lenoxdale, Mass.) had a solid appearance in relief, allowing just one run on four hits in five innings, striking out two.
